Re: [nservicebus] 1.9 stability

Great news Udi.  We load tested our full duplex and pub/sub scenarios the other day at about 500 messages per second with no hiccups at all.  Because of our CQS architecture is very common for our full duplex responses to include publishing up to several one way messages and its all working out great under our load testing.

On Sat, Feb 7, 2009 at 2:19 AM, Udi Dahan <thesoftwaresimplist@...> wrote:

One of my clients has started heavy load testing on 1.9 planning on going to production the end of this month.

They're doing millions of sagas a day each managing an IO intensive process.

 

So far, so good J
